Output 8431c8126dd48b0da32343b5084ad70e221039d8627bcdf806072abd748a5a75:0

value
541504
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fec27622df3d7e0a7eee81689a2c0515af6635ca OP_EQUAL
address
3Qv4WgtEPyyjYi2MqiE5GaUjTP13bGUxk4
transaction
8431c8126dd48b0da32343b5084ad70e221039d8627bcdf806072abd748a5a75
spent
true